Government Wage Policy, Wage Determination, and the Development Process: A Case Study of Tanzania
This is a study of the role of government wage policy (GWP) in economic development and labor market behavior with special reference to Tanzania. GWP includes not only direct action on wages, but legal and institutional changes which indirectly affect labor market processes and industrial relations.

The Geographies of the $15 Wage Movement: New Union Campaigns, Mobility Politics, and Local Minimum Wage Policies
The $15 wage movement has grown substantially since the first $15 minimum wage initiative was passed in SeaTac, Washington in 2013.
